Meat-loving coffee drinkers are repeatedly told by epidemiologists that their gastronomy will be their doom as studies reveal that fruit, vegetables and water are best for a healthy life. With one exception: more vegetarians tend to commit suicide.

Now scientists have found further evidence that a traditionally unhealthy diet could mean a better mood. A study published in Archives of Internal Medicine, of 87,000 women nurses, has found that those who drank two or three cups of coffee a day had one third of the risk of committing suicide of those who drank no coffee. Put this together with recent findings on alcoholic drinks and it looks like the remedy for the stressful life is: high fat, caffeine and alcohol.
